THE KINEMATIC SEQUENCE
During the downswing, each body segment accelerates, peaks, then decelerates — transferring energy to the next. The timing between peaks determines everything.
ENERGY LOSS
When segments overlap or fire out of order, energy leaks instead of transfers. You can't feel 15ms — but the ball can.
SENSOR PRECISION
Cameras at 30fps have 33ms between frames — longer than the gap between segment peaks. Our IMU sensors capture at 1666Hz, resolving timing differences invisible to video.
The gap between segment peaks is 20-50ms. At 30fps, a camera captures one frame in that window. Our IMU captures 33-83 data points.
